Expert Drainage & Grading in Atlanta, GA

Drainage and grading problems are common across Atlanta backyards. The city averages around 50 inches of rain per year, and that rain often arrives in short, heavy bursts. Atlanta's dense red clay soil absorbs water slowly, so runoff pools fast and lingers. At J Goldsmith Design, we assess how water currently moves across your property. We identify low spots, slope direction, and soil compaction before recommending a fix. Our backyard renovation work may include regrading to redirect water away from your home, installing French drains to pull subsurface water out, adding catch basins to capture surface runoff, or shaping swales that guide water to a safe outlet. Every solution is designed around your specific yard, not a one-size approach. If your backyard stays soggy after rain, loses grass in wet spots, or shows erosion along slopes, those are signs your drainage needs attention. If your Atlanta backyard holds standing water after rain or shows bare muddy patches where grass won't grow, the grade or drainage system likely needs correction. Both problems often appear together and are best evaluated on-site.

Yes, proper grading and drainage solutions can stop erosion on sloped Atlanta yards by redirecting runoff before it carves channels or washes away topsoil. The right approach depends on the degree of slope and how water currently moves across the property.

Some disturbance to the yard is expected during grading and drainage installation, but a well-planned approach minimizes impact to existing plants and hardscape. J Goldsmith Design scopes each Atlanta backyard project to protect as much of the existing landscape as possible.

Atlanta's red clay soil absorbs water much more slowly than sandy or loamy soils, which means standard fixes used in other regions often fall short here. Solutions designed specifically for clay conditions, like French drains and targeted regrading, produce more reliable results.

Water pooling near a foundation in Atlanta usually means the yard slopes toward the house instead of away from it. Regrading the area around the foundation to create a positive slope away from the structure is the most direct correction.

Yes, drainage and grading are often the first step in a backyard renovation because they set the foundation for everything built after. Addressing water flow before adding patios, planting beds, or lawn areas protects the entire project long-term.
